Understanding Cybersecurity
Cybersecurity is a crucial practice that involves safeguarding electronic systems, networks, and data from breaches, cyberattacks, and potential harm. It encompasses various approaches, technologies, and best practices that work together to protect digital assets and preserve the confidentiality, integrity, and availability of sensitive information.
Types of Cyber Threats
Before diving into cybersecurity basics, it's crucial to grasp the common types of cyber threats that can compromise our digital security:
1. Malware: Short for malicious software, malware includes viruses, worms, Trojans, and ransomware. Malware infects systems and can lead to data loss, theft, or unauthorized access.
2. Phishing: Phishing attacks involve cybercriminals posing as legitimate entities to deceive individuals into revealing sensitive information such as passwords, credit card details, or personal data.
3. Social Engineering: This manipulation tactic exploits human psychology to trick individuals into divulging confidential information or performing actions that benefit the attacker.
4. Data Breaches: Unauthorized access to sensitive or confidential data, often resulting in its exposure or theft. Data breaches can have severe financial, legal, and reputational consequences.
Foundations of Cybersecurity: Key Concepts
1. Authentication and Authorization: Authentication confirms the identity of users, while authorization determines what actions they are allowed to perform. Strong authentication mechanisms, such as multi-factor authentication (MFA), enhance security.
2. Encryption: Encryption converts data into an unreadable format using cryptographic algorithms. Only authorized parties with the decryption key can access the original data.
3. Firewalls: Firewalls act as barriers between a trusted internal network and untrusted external networks, monitoring and controlling incoming and outgoing traffic to prevent unauthorized access.
4. Patch Management: Regularly updating software and applications with the latest security patches ensures that known vulnerabilities are addressed, reducing the risk of exploitation.
5. Least Privilege: The principle of least privilege advocates granting users only the minimum access rights necessary to perform their tasks. This minimizes potential damage if an account is compromised.
6. Backup and Recovery: Regularly backing up data to secure locations ensures that information can be restored in case of data loss due to cyberattacks or technical failures.
Cybersecurity Best Practices for Individuals
1. Strong Passwords: Create strong, unique passwords for each account by combining letters, numbers, and special characters. Avoid using easily guessable information like birthdays or names.
2. Multi-Factor Authentication (MFA): Enable MFA whenever possible to add an extra layer of security. MFA requires users to provide multiple forms of verification before gaining access to an account.
3. Phishing Awareness: Be cautious of unsolicited emails or messages requesting personal information or urging immediate action. Verify the sender's authenticity before responding.
4. Secure Wi-Fi Connections: Use encrypted Wi-Fi networks, and avoid connecting to public networks without proper security measures. Public Wi-Fi networks are often vulnerable to attacks.
5. Regular Software Updates: Keep your operating system, applications, and antivirus software up to date to protect against known vulnerabilities.
6. Social Media Privacy Settings: Adjust privacy settings on social media platforms to control who can access your personal information.
7. Device Security: Use strong passwords or biometric authentication for devices, and consider encrypting data stored on them.
Cybersecurity Practices for Businesses and Organizations
1. Employee Training: Regularly educate employees about cybersecurity best practices and potential threats to cultivate a security-conscious culture.
2. Network Security: Implement firewalls, intrusion detection systems, and encryption to safeguard the organization's network infrastructure.
3. Access Control: Limit user access to data and systems to prevent unauthorized personnel from accessing sensitive information.
4. Incident Response Plan: Develop a comprehensive plan outlining steps to take in the event of a cyber incident, minimizing damage and downtime.
5. Regular Audits: Conduct regular security audits and assessments to identify vulnerabilities and ensure compliance with security standards.
6.Vendor and Third-Party Risk Management: Assess the cybersecurity practices of vendors and third-party partners, as their vulnerabilities can potentially affect your organization.
Emerging Trends and Challenges
1. Artificial Intelligence (AI) and Machine Learning (ML): While AI and ML offer enhanced cybersecurity capabilities, they can also be exploited by cybercriminals to orchestrate more sophisticated attacks.
2. Internet of Things (IoT) Security: With the proliferation of IoT devices, securing them is crucial to prevent potential vulnerabilities that could be exploited by hackers.
3. Ransomware and Extortion: Ransomware attacks continue to evolve, targeting organizations and individuals alike. Paying ransoms doesn't guarantee data recovery and may further incentivize attackers.
